Synopsis

Demons Don't Dream is book sixteen in the series of Xanth.  Two Mundanians discover Xanth through a computer game: Dug, a young man who is beguiled by a beautiful serpent-princess in the game, and Kim, who discovers her favorite fantasy realm has suddenly become frighteningly real.
